171,408 is a composite number, even.
171,408 (one hundred seventy-one thousand four hundred eight) is an even 6-digit number. It is a composite number with 20 divisors, and factors as 2⁴ × 3 × 3,571. Its proper divisors sum to 271,520,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x29D90.
